• 產品與解決方案
  • 行業解決方案
  • 服務
  • 支持
  • 合作夥伴
  • 關於我們

02 二層技術-以太網交換命令參考

目錄

10-QinQ命令

本章節下載 10-QinQ命令  (111.48 KB)

10-QinQ命令


1 QinQ配置命令

1.1  QinQ配置命令

1.1.1  qinq enable

【命令】

qinq enable

undo qinq enable

【視圖】

二層以太網端口視圖/二層聚合接口視圖/端口組視圖

【缺省級別】

2:係統級

【參數】

【描述】

qinq enable命令用來使能端口的基本QinQ功能。undo qinq enable命令用來關閉端口的基本QinQ功能。

缺省情況下,端口的基本QinQ功能處於關閉狀態。

使能了基本QinQ功能的端口將為其收到的報文添加新的VLAN Tag,該VLAN Tag即該端口缺省VLAN的Tag。

需要注意的是,二層以太網端口視圖下的配置隻對當前端口有效;二層聚合接口視圖下的配置對當前接口及其對應聚合組內的所有成員端口都有效;端口組視圖下的配置對當前端口組中的所有端口有效。

【舉例】

# 在端口Ethernet1/0/1上使能基本QinQ功能。

<Sysname> system-view

[Sysname] interface ethernet 1/0/1

[Sysname-Ethernet1/0/1] qinq enable

# 在端口組1中的所有端口上都使能基本QinQ功能。

<Sysname> system-view

[Sysname] port-group manual 1

[Sysname-port-group-manual-1] group-member ethernet 1/0/1 to ethernet 1/0/6

[Sysname-port-group-manual-1] qinq enable

1.1.2  qinq ethernet-type

【命令】

qinq ethernet-type  hex-value

undo qinq ethernet-type

【視圖】

二層以太網端口視圖/二層聚合端口視圖/端口組視圖

【缺省級別】

2:係統級

【參數】

hex-value:表示十六進製格式的TPID(Tag Protocol Identifier,標簽協議標識符)值,取值範圍為0x0001~0xFFFF,但不允許配置為表1-1中列舉的常用協議類型值。

表1-1 常用協議類型值

協議類型

協議類型值

ARP

0x0806

PUP

0x0200

RARP

0x8035

IP

0x0800

IPv6

0x86DD

PPPoE

0x8863/0x8864

MPLS

0x8847/0x8848

IPX/SPX

0x8137

IS-IS

0x8000

LACP

0x8809

802.1x

0x888E

集群

0x88A7

設備保留

0xFFFD/0xFFFE/0xFFFF

 

【描述】

qinq ethernet-type命令用來配置VLAN Tag中攜帶的TPID值。undo qinq ethernet-type命令用來恢複TPID值為缺省值。

缺省情況下,VLAN Tag中所攜帶的TPID值為0x8100。

【舉例】

# 配置TPID值為0x8200。

<Sysname> system-view

[Sysname] interface ethernet 1/0/1

[Sysname-Ethernet1/0/1] qinq ethernet-type 8200

1.1.3  qinq vid

【命令】

qinq vid vlan-id

undo qinq vid vlan-id

【視圖】

二層以太網端口視圖/二層聚合端口視圖/端口組視圖

【缺省級別】

2:係統級

【參數】

vlan-id:外層VLAN的VLAN ID,取值範圍為1~4094。

【描述】

qinq vid命令用來進入QinQ視圖,並配置端口添加的外層VLAN Tag。undo qinq vid命令用來刪除該VLAN ID對應QinQ視圖下的所有配置。

需要注意的是:

·     二層以太網接口視圖下的配置隻對當前端口有效;二層聚合接口視圖下的配置對當前接口及其對應聚合組內的所有成員端口都有效;端口組視圖下的配置對當前端口組中的所有端口有效。

·     為端口配置添加外層VLAN Tag後,必須要通過命令行raw-vlan-id inbound指定需添加外層VLAN Tag的內層VLAN Tag。

相關配置可參考命令raw-vlan-id inbound

【舉例】

# 在端口Ethernet1/0/1上配置靈活QinQ功能,並配置該端口添加的外層VLAN Tag為10。

<Sysname> system-view

[Sysname] interface ethernet 1/0/1

[Sysname-Ethernet1/0/1] qinq vid 10

# 在端口組1中的所有端口上配置靈活QinQ功能,並配置該端口組中所有端口添加的外層VLAN Tag為10。

<Sysname> system-view

[Sysname] port-group manual 1

[Sysname-port-group-manual-1] group-member ethernet 1/0/1 to ethernet 1/0/6

[Sysname-port-group-manual-1] qinq vid 10

1.1.4  raw-vlan-id inbound

【命令】

raw-vlan-id inbound { all | vlan-list }

undo raw-vlan-id inbound { all | vlan-list }

【視圖】

QinQ視圖

【缺省級別】

2:係統級

【參數】

vlan-list:VLAN列表,表示多個VLAN的ID。表示方式為vlan-list = { vlan-id [ to vlan-id ] }&<1-10>。其中,vlan-id為指定VLAN的ID,取值範圍為1~4094,to之後的VLAN ID要大於或等於to之前的VLAN ID。&<1-10>表示前麵的參數最多可以輸入10次。

all:表示所有VLAN。

【描述】

raw-vlan-id inbound命令用來配置需添加外層VLAN Tag的內層VLAN Tag。undo raw-vlan-id inbound命令用來取消該配置。

需要注意的是:

·     用戶可在同一視圖下多次配置該命令,各個配置之間互相不覆蓋,配置值自動按照從小到大的順序排列。

·     一個內層VLAN Tag隻能對應一個外層VLAN Tag。如果用戶想改變報文的外層VLAN Tag,需要先刪除舊的外層VLAN Tag配置,然後再配置新的外層VLAN Tag。

相關配置可參考命令qinq vid

【舉例】

# 在端口Ethernet1/0/1上配置為VLAN 3、5、20~100的報文添加VLAN ID為100的外層VLAN Tag。

<Sysname> system-view

[Sysname] interface ethernet 1/0/1

[Sysname-Ethernet1/0/1] qinq vid 100

[Sysname-Ethernet1/0/1-vid-100] raw-vlan-id inbound 3 5 20 to 100

 

不同款型規格的資料略有差異, 詳細信息請向具體銷售和400谘詢。H3C保留在沒有任何通知或提示的情況下對資料內容進行修改的權利!

BOB登陆
官網
聯係我們